METHOD AND DEVICE FOR COMPRESSING SEQUENCE OF ORDERED M-TH ALPHABET CHARACTERS BEING CODED INTO CODED SEQUENCE OF BINARY CHARACTERS Russian patent published in 2001 - IPC

Abstract RU 2168857 C1

FIELD: electric communications; compression of digital messages for their transmission and storage. SUBSTANCE: method used for compressing digital messages such as voice, sound, television, facsimile, and the like messages to facilitate their transmission and storage involves pre-shaping approximating sequences to be coded, coding them, determining and comparing length of each approximating coded sequence with preset maximum permissible length, erasing approximating sequences to be coded for which lengths of respective approximating coded sequence is greater than maximum permissible length, selecting one of approximating sequences to be coded closest to sequence to be coded, and taking it as coded sequence of binary characters. Device implementing this method has identifying unit, statistical parameter computing unit, first and second normalizing units, first, second, and third normalizing shift registers, subtracter, comparator, first, second, and third switching units, adder, first and second coding-parameter storage units, code interval register, first and second left-hand shift registers, lower coding boundary register, as well as newly introduced unit for sequence to be coded, memory unit for approximating sequences to be coded, switch, selection unit, memory unit for approximating coded sequences, comparison unit, and maximum length memory unit. EFFECT: reduced time of coded data transmission over communication channel; reduced memory capacity required for coded sequence storage device. 10 cl, 27 dwg
